What is male/female socket weld?

Is that the same with male/female Threaded?

So the male socketweld is buttweld,Is that right?
 
Socket welded connections are a type of welded connection where there is a male component that slides into a female component and then a fillet weld is made between the shoulder of the female component and shank of the male component.

Please refer to ASME B16.11 for typical dimensions and details.
 
120mg7p.png
 
A male socket welding end does not normally have any reduction in outside diameter. The outside diameter is constant and a fillet weld is used. The official dimensions for socket welded components would be specified in ASME B16.11.
 
Would like to back up rneill's contribution, and add that you're looking at a valve that has a "normal" SW end (female) with the other being male.
